From bb1ec86f9da24fe6b49bae68353d53ba96b7228f Mon Sep 17 00:00:00 2001 From: Pierre Joye Date: Wed, 8 Mar 2006 00:43:32 +0000 Subject: - remove magic_quotes_gpc, magic_quotes_runtime, magic_quotes_sybase (calling ini_set('magic_....') returns 0|false - get_magic_quotes_gpc, get_magic_quotes_runtime are kept but always return false - set_magic_quotes_runtime raises an E_CORE_ERROR --- ext/mysql/php_mysql.c | 16 +++------------- 1 file changed, 3 insertions(+), 13 deletions(-) (limited to 'ext/mysql/php_mysql.c') diff --git a/ext/mysql/php_mysql.c b/ext/mysql/php_mysql.c index b9288c6bf6..52141f5327 100644 --- a/ext/mysql/php_mysql.c +++ b/ext/mysql/php_mysql.c @@ -1841,13 +1841,8 @@ PHP_FUNCTION(mysql_result) if (sql_row[field_offset]) { Z_TYPE_P(return_value) = IS_STRING; - - if (PG(magic_quotes_runtime)) { - Z_STRVAL_P(return_value) = php_addslashes(sql_row[field_offset], sql_row_lengths[field_offset],&Z_STRLEN_P(return_value), 0 TSRMLS_CC); - } else { - Z_STRLEN_P(return_value) = sql_row_lengths[field_offset]; - Z_STRVAL_P(return_value) = (char *) safe_estrndup(sql_row[field_offset], Z_STRLEN_P(return_value)); - } + Z_STRLEN_P(return_value) = sql_row_lengths[field_offset]; + Z_STRVAL_P(return_value) = (char *) safe_estrndup(sql_row[field_offset], Z_STRLEN_P(return_value)); } else { Z_TYPE_P(return_value) = IS_NULL; } @@ -1970,12 +1965,7 @@ static void php_mysql_fetch_hash(INTERNAL_FUNCTION_PARAMETERS, int result_type, MAKE_STD_ZVAL(data); - if (PG(magic_quotes_runtime)) { - Z_TYPE_P(data) = IS_STRING; - Z_STRVAL_P(data) = php_addslashes(mysql_row[i], mysql_row_lengths[i], &Z_STRLEN_P(data), 0 TSRMLS_CC); - } else { - ZVAL_STRINGL(data, mysql_row[i], mysql_row_lengths[i], 1); - } + ZVAL_STRINGL(data, mysql_row[i], mysql_row_lengths[i], 1); if (result_type & MYSQL_NUM) { add_index_zval(return_value, i, data); -- cgit v1.2.1